It was effectively a Spotify player for cars that didn't have streaming functionality, and served as an informative experiment for the company. Spotify first shared word of Car Thing in 2019, but the finished product only reached the broader public early this year following several months of invitation-only sales. You can still buy the Car Thing for $50 (down from the usual $90) as of this writing. The company said it still "unlocked helpful learnings" from the device despite its brief history, and that the car remained an "important place" for audio. The withdrawal hurt Spotify's gross profits.Įxisting Car Thing units will still work as expected, Spotify said. In a statement to Engadget, a company spokesperson pinned the decision on "several factors" that included customer demand and supply chain problems. As part of its earnings data, the streaming service revealed that it stopped manufacturing its Car Thing player.
